Stanley Eugene Kreger, 91, of Huntsville, AL, died Sunday, October 31, 2004 at his residence in Huntsville, AL. He was born March 22, 1913 in Aide, OH, the son of Albert and Olive Russell Kreger. He was a member of the Huntsville First United Methodist Church, the Huntsville, AL South Point Ohio Masonic Lodge, Redstone Arsenal Officer's Club, Huntsville, AL, and Huntsville Elks Club #1648. He was a graduate of Ohio State University in 1937, and retired as a Lt. Colonel with the U. S. Army, having served in WWII.

He married Anna Delay on May 23, 1946 and she preceded him in death on January 18, 1973. He was also preceded in death by his parents; his brother, Ben Kreger; and his sister, Maude Kreger.

He is survived by his son and daughter-in-law, Timothy E. and Dominique Kreger, Huntsville, AL; his daughter, Pamela Wynn, Huntsville, AL; and 5 grandchildren, Kevin Wynn, Timmy Wynn, Justin Wynn, Cale Kreger, and Jack Kreger, all of Huntsville, AL.
